Café Buade is a local restaurant that offers a calm and relaxing atmosphere. The food is fresh, with the soup of the day being particularly delicious. The service is generally fast, and the staff are friendly, even for those who don't speak French. While one customer found the chicken poutine to be bland, with undercooked fries and a hair on the plate, another found the poutine to be just okay. Some customers noted that the fish and chips had no flavor and the club sandwich had little meat. However, the majority of reviews still praise the quality of the food, including the regular poutine and turnip soup. Prices are described as average, and the restaurant is a recommended dining destination. Despite some mixed experiences with specific meals like Egg Benedict and crepes, the restaurant maintains a welcoming vibe, with servers often noted for their personality and attentiveness.
